Movable communication tower
Technical field
The present invention relates to technical field of communication equipment, specific field is movable communication tower.
Background technology
Communications tower belongs to one kind of signal transmitting tower, is also signal transmitting tower or signal tower, and major function supports signal hair Penetrate, supported for signal transmitting antenna.The communication sections such as purposes movement/UNICOM/traffic global position system (GPS).It is general logical The construction of news tower pours the special ground of tower body using concrete more, and tower body is installed on ground, and this mounting means takes up an area Area is big and needs the cost that puts into higher, once installation site cannot be changed easily by installing.It is and existing middle-size and small-size Movable communication tower is mostly troublesome in poeration, wastes time and energy, and the support fixed effect to communication tower is not very after movement It is preferable.A kind of therefore, it is proposed that movable communication tower.

Embodiment
Below in conjunction with the accompanying drawing in the embodiment of the present invention, the technical scheme in the embodiment of the present invention is carried out clear, complete Site preparation describes, it is clear that described embodiment is only part of the embodiment of the present invention, rather than whole embodiments.It is based on Embodiment in the present invention, those of ordinary skill in the art are obtained every other under the premise of creative work is not made Embodiment, belong to the scope of protection of the invention.
Referring to Fig. 1, the present invention provides a kind of technical scheme:Movable communication tower, including tower body 1 and base 2, it is described Tower body is installed on the upper end of the base, and the lower end corner of the base is equipped with supporting leg 3, and supporting leg plays branch to base and tower body The effect of support, the lower sides of the supporting leg are provided with collateral plate 4, and collateral plate adds the stability that supporting leg supports to base, institute State the lower end corner of base and travel mechanism 5 is respectively equipped with the inside of the supporting leg, travel mechanism can be such that base enters with tower body Row movement;
Fig. 2 and Fig. 3 are referred to, the travel mechanism includes support column 51, telescopic chute is provided with the middle part of the lower surface of the support column 52, the inside of the telescopic chute is provided with piston 53, and piston can be movable in telescopic chute, and the projection in telescopic chute top sidewall Piston is set to be provided with push rod 54 without departing from telescopic chute, the lower end of the piston, piston can drive push rod movable, under the push rod End is connected with turning rolls 56 by steering mechanism 55, and steering mechanism can be turned to turning rolls, be provided with the turning rolls Roller 57, roller may move whole device, be provided with hydraulic press 58 in the middle part of the lower surface of the base, the hydraulic press it is fuel-displaced End is connected with each telescopic chute respectively by petroleum pipeline 59, when hydraulic press input hydraulic pressure oil into telescopic chute, hydraulic oil Piston movement is promoted, piston movement drives push rod movement, and push rod, which promotes steering mechanism and turning rolls, stretches out telescopic chute, now Roller contacts with ground, and supporting leg departs from ground, and communication tower can be moved, and when needing the position fixation to communication tower, stretches Hydraulic oil in contracting groove is back to hydraulic press, piston driving roller retraction telescopic chute, and now supporting leg plays support to base and fixed Effect.
Referring to Fig. 4, specifically, the steering mechanism includes top rotary table 551 and lower rotary table 552, top rotary table and lower turn Disk can be relatively rotated, and the top rotary table is fixedly connected with the lower end of the push rod, and the lower rotary table is fixed with the turning rolls to be connected Connect, be provided with rotary shaft 553 in the middle part of the lower surface of the top rotary table, the lower end of the rotary shaft is provided with position-arresting disk 554, described lower turn The upper surface middle part of disk is provided with axial trough 555, and the bottom of the axial trough is provided with stopper slot 556, and the rotary shaft stretches into the axial trough, The position-arresting disk stretches into the stopper slot, and when top rotary table and lower rotary table relatively rotate, rotary shaft and position-arresting disk can be respectively in axles Rotated in groove and stopper slot, prevent top rotary table from departing from lower rotary table.
Refer to Fig. 4 specifically, the turning rolls includes symmetrically arranged baffle plate 561, the upper end of the baffle plate with The lower surface of the lower rotary table is fixedly connected, and is provided with fixing axle 562 between the lower sidewall of the baffle plate, the roller with it is described Fixing axle is rotatablely installed.
Specifically, the side wall of the base is provided with controller 6, the controller and the hydraulic pressure mechatronics, passes through Controller controls fuel feeding and oil return of the hydraulic press into telescopic chute.
Specifically, the contact position of the top rotary table and the lower rotary table is uniformly provided with ball, increases top rotary table and lower turn Rotating effect during relative rotation between disk.
Specifically, the position-arresting disk and the diameter ratio of the rotary shaft are more than 1, the stopper slot and the axial trough Diameter ratio is more than 1, and the diameter of position-arresting disk is bigger than rotary shaft just to play spacing effect, avoid top rotary table from being taken off with lower rotary table From.
Specifically, the contact position of the roller and the fixing axle is provided with bearing, and bearing increases the rotating effect of roller.
Operation principle:When hydraulic press input hydraulic pressure oil into telescopic chute, hydraulic oil promotes piston movement, piston moving belt Dynamic push rod movement, push rod, which promotes steering mechanism and turning rolls, stretches out telescopic chute, and now roller contacts with ground, and supporting leg departs from Ground, communication tower can be moved, when needing the position fixation to communication tower, the hydraulic oil in telescopic chute is back to hydraulic pressure Machine, piston driving roller retraction telescopic chute, now supporting leg the fixed effect of support is played to base, top rotary table and lower rotary table can phases To rotating, when top rotary table and lower rotary table relatively rotate, rotary shaft and position-arresting disk can rotate in axial trough and stopper slot respectively, prevent Only turning rolls departs from push rod.
